Innovations in agricultural technology have brought forth a new era in farming, with advanced tools and equipment designed to increase efficiency and productivity. One such innovation is the advanced multifunctional tiller in cultivators, which is revolutionizing the way farmers prepare their fields for planting.
Traditionally, farmers used manual tools such as hoes and plows to till the soil, a labor-intensive and time-consuming process. However, with the advancement of technology, cultivators equipped with multifunctional tillers have made the task of tilling the soil much easier and faster.
The advanced multifunctional tillers are capable of performing multiple tasks in one pass, such as tilling, leveling, and mixing the soil. This eliminates the need for multiple machines, saving farmers time and labor costs. The tillers are also customizable, allowing farmers to adjust the depth and configuration to suit their specific needs.
In addition to saving time and labor, the advanced multifunctional tillers also improve soil health and fertility. By thoroughly mixing and aerating the soil, the tillers create a more conducive environment for plant growth. This leads to higher crop yields and better quality produce.
Furthermore, the tillers are designed for ease of use, with user-friendly controls and ergonomic features. This makes them accessible to farmers of all skill levels, allowing even those with limited experience to operate the machines effectively.
